    Abstract: Apparatus and related method for taking a sample of molten metal from a vessel comprising a refractory block installed in a wall of the vessel before the vessel is filled with molten metal. The block is traversed by at least one passage having a closure element to initially block the passage. A rigid elongated pipe is movable lengthwise in the passage and a sample mould is operatively associated with the pipe. There is means activatable to advance the pipe forcibly in a forward direction to cause a forward end of the pipe to engage the closure element for unblocking the passage whereby molten metal gains access to the pipe and flows along the pipe to enter the mould.

    Abstract: An injection nozzle for installation in the wall of a vessel for introducing gas into a liquid in the vessel. The nozzle comprises a body pierced by a passage which is terminated at the discharge end of the nozzle by a gas-porous or foraminous passage-closing means. Means is provided gas-tightly affixed to the closing means to feed gas thereto. The gas-feeding means includes a duct structure which extends along the passage between the closing means and the inlet end of the body. The duct structure provides a substantially leak-tight gas-feed path from an external gas delivery means to the passage-closing means. The duct structure can be adjustable or extensible in length.

    Abstract: For injecting gas into a liquid, more particularly a molten metal, a nozzle body (24) is installed in the wall of a liquid containment vessel, the body (24) having a nozzle passage (25) therethrough. Liquid and gas tightly fitted in a downstream end of the passage is solid, gas porous plug (18) having capillary gas passage (20). Upstream of the plug (18) the passage has a gas-porous and liquid-impermeable cartridge (10) closely fitted therein which prevents liquid which may conceivably pass through the plug (18) from leaking out of the passage (25). The cartridge (10) has a gas impermeable metal sleeve (11) containing a particulate material (16) such as sand which is retained in the sleeve (11) by wads (14, 15) of fibrous material at the ends of the sleeve.

    Abstract: Gates for sliding gate valves in which refractory elements are cemented within metal enclosure trays include an inner refractory member that contains the metal pour opening and an outer refractory member that surrounds the inner member. Only the inner member in each gate is designed to be contacted in service by molten metal and is replaceably secured in the tray which have apertures for access of tooling used to displace the inner member out of the tray when replacement of the member is required.

    Abstract: In submerged teeming operations the extended pouring tube which receives molten metal from a vessel via a nozzle has gas admitted thereto for protecting it against molten metal attack. A union block is sandwiched between the nozzle and pouring tube, block being surrounded by a metal jacket spaced therefrom to form a gas manifold to be fed with gas via a gas supply pipe. Gas admitted to the manifold is ejected, around the lower end of the union block, by a surrounding annular orifice into the pouring tube and flows downwardly along the wall thereof as a protective gas film.

    Abstract: A metal pouring ladle furnished with a sliding gate valve has a bottom pour opening fitted with a well block and a nozzle seated in the lower portion thereof, the well block and nozzle forming a flow passage leading to the valve. For introducing gas to the melt, a pipe is cast in the well block, the pipe opening to the bore of the well block above the nozzle or into an annular space encircling the top end of the nozzle component. This permits gassing before teeming commences without recourse to the flow passage through the nozzle, and so gassing is possible without disturbing any particulate silicious filler which may have been placed in the nozzle passage.

    Abstract: Oxidation of a molten metal pour stream is prevented by enclosing the stream in a shroud formed by one or more jets of inert gas arranged to envelope the stream.
